Edith I. Rucker, 97 years, of Monroe, MI passed away Tuesday, April 28, 2009 at 11:54 AM in Mercy Memorial Hospital where she had been for the past week. Edith was born June 5, 1911 in Arthur, TN the eldest of 13 children of the late Henley and Sarah (Maples) Bussell. On June 23, 1929 in Cumberland Gap, TN, Edith married her beloved husband Frank R. Rucker. Sadly, he preceded her in death on December 15, 1963. A true Christian woman, Edith enjoyed reading her Bible and was a member of Frenchtown Missionary Baptist Church. A homemaker, Edith enjoyed cooking, sewing, gardening, and puzzle books. Edith was quite the story teller and enjoyed sharing her stories with her many friends and with her family whom she loved with all her heart. Edith is survived by 3 beloved children; Christine Standifer of LaSalle, MI, William (Ruby) Rucker of Port Clinton, MI and Willard (Shirley Ann) Rucker of Tazewell, TN, a brother; Ulus (Judy) Bussell of Newport, MI, 3 sisters; Bertha Cole of Temperance, MI, Lois Gibson-Reed of Monroe and Lorene McBee of Niceville, FL, 11 cherished grandchildren, 20 treasured great grandchildren and 13 treasured great great grandchildren. In addition to her husband and parents Edith was preceded in death by 2 daughters; Ethel Rucker and Ester Catron, 5 brothers and 3 sisters.
